On a recent trip to the USA, I had the opportunity to drive a vehicle with adaptive cruise control.
It was a Toyota Corolla rental car and I was unaware the vehicle even had this feature until I was on the highway.
I’m a big fan of cruise control, where your attention is focused solely on the road, rather than constantly looking down at the speedo.
While driving down the highway, I noticed the car started to decelerate without my input and I thought something was wrong with the vehicle.
It wasn’t until I looked on the digital dash that I saw the car was modifying its speed based on a radar that identified a vehicle enter my lane ahead which was travelling slower than me.
